Rivers, Beaches, Forests, Caves, Camping, Hiking! Oh My!
This magical island boasts about 5,385 miles of river, with approximately 225 named rivers. Simply walking along a river can lead you to countless hidden gems. Add to that over 300 beautiful beaches, each with its own unique charm and magic.
There’s a river or beach for every day of the year—and more! Puerto Rico’s condensed size means you can explore multiple spots in a single day, but why rush? Take your time to savor each one. Discover waterfalls tucked away in lush greenery and watch breathtaking sunsets that will linger in your memory forever.
The miles of coastline offer incredible snorkeling and diving adventures. Puerto Rico is home to vibrant marine life—turtles, stingrays, colorful fish, and even the occasional barracuda. Shark sightings are rare here, so you can swim without fear.
For surfers, Puerto Rico has plenty to offer, with incredible waves in areas like Rincón, Isabela, Aguadilla, and Manatí.
Adventures Beyond the Shore
For those seeking even more adventure, Puerto Rico is a nature lover’s playground. Go hiking in the lush trails of El Yunque Rainforest or explore the island’s many caves—some of which are adorned with ancient indigenous hieroglyphs. Try your hand at rock climbing, rappelling, or even camping. You can pitch your tent by a secluded river or beach and let nature be your sanctuary.
As for wildlife, Puerto Rico is teeming with life. You’ll see reptiles like iguanas, vibrant birds, and, on nearby islands like Vieques and Culebra, wild horses and deer. Puerto Rico has no venomous creatures roaming about, making it a safe haven for exploring freely.
